A List of Totally Do-Able New Years Resolutions
http://www.visitphilly.com

1. Read a book.

2. Or read a couple.

3. Master the cooking of a really hard meal.

4. Or learn how to make a bunch of easy ones.

5. Eat an apple every day. Or some kind of fruit or vegetable.

6. Start your day an hour earlier. You'd be surprised at how helpful it could be.

7. Dedicate an hour a week to free writing. Even if it's just scribbles or nonsense, it's a good way to express yourself.

8. Find a new band or artist that you really like. There are a million out there that you could love and not even know about.

9. Learn some of their songs. Maybe even go to a concert.

10. Call your mom more.

11. Or your dad.

12. Or your grandparents, aunts, uncles, cousins and siblings. They'll appreciate it.

13. Find a new hairstyle. Because it's possible that you've been going your whole life without the right one.

14. Save a small amount of money every week and spend it on something extravagant at the end of the year. Maybe that camera you always wanted or a little weekend getaway.

15. Try a food that you've never eaten.

16. Try a food you ate when you were little and didn't like. Your tastebuds change every few years so you could be missing out.

17. Go to more free school-sponsored activities. They'll get you out of the dorm without breaking your wallet.

18. Try and do your homework the day it's assigned instead of the day before it's due to avoid falling behind.

19. Listen to your discover weekly on Spotify. Maybe you'll find something good.

20. Learn how to make a cake from scratch. Or brownies. Or cookies. Your grandma would be proud.

21. Learn how to knit or crochet. Your grandma would be even prouder.

22. Deal with stress by painting instead of binge-watching Netflix to make you feel more productive.

23. Keep your room clean by putting things away as soon as your done with them, instead of letting the mess pile up.

24. Explore New Jersey. Who say's traveling only counts when it's a plane ride away? There are a bunch of free landmarks and state parks all around us that are free and still have breathtaking views.

25. Go to a random movie with your best friends without worrying about the rating or previews. Anything is enjoyable with the right company.

26. Try that restaurant that always caught your eye.

27. Make a happy playlist to start your day with. It sets the mood for your whole day.

28. Spend a day in New York City. There are so many awesome things there that you might not have known about and some of them are cheaper than you think.

29. Try and say something nice to someone every day. Not only will it make their day brighter, but yours too.

30. Volunteer at least once. There are a bunch of charities that could use your help.
